What You'll Do

Depending on your experience and training, you may:
  • Assist veterinarians with appointments, diagnostics, and treatments
  • Provide safe, compassionate patient restraint and handling
  • Obtain patient histories and document medical records
  • Prepare exam rooms and treatment areas
  • Collect laboratory samples and assist with in-house diagnostics
  • Administer medications and treatments as directed
  • Assist with surgery, dentistry, anesthesia, and patient recovery
  • Monitor hospitalized patients and communicate changes to the medical team
  • Educate clients on medications, preventative care, and discharge instructions
  • Maintain a clean, organized, and efficient hospital
  • Support an exceptional experience for every client and patient

Veterinary Technicians
with LVT, RVT, or CVT credentials are encouraged to apply; experienced non-credentialed technicians are also welcome. Experience with laboratory diagnostics, radiology, dentistry, surgery, or anesthesia monitoring is a plus.

This is an active, hands-on role requiring the ability to lift and restrain animals up to 50 pounds, stand and walk for extended periods, and frequently bend, kneel, reach, and move throughout the hospital. Team members should be comfortable safely handling animals of varying sizes and temperaments, including fearful or fractious patients, and working around animal dander, bodily fluids, cleaning products, medications, and other veterinary hospital materials while following appropriate safety, sanitation, and PPE protocols.
